Connecting an Optional Microphone
You can output your voice from the system by connecting a dynamic microphone with a normal plug.

NOTES
• Microphone is not supplied.
• When using the wireless Group Play or stereo mode function, sound from the microphone is only
output from the system to which the microphone is connected.
• There may be distortion or noise caused by the quality of the microphone that is connected.
